Output 63d683675620c0d8f8bf813d2261273d3da22bc452bd1d3925542c20dcb703d5:0

value
86331887
script pubkey
OP_HASH160 OP_PUSHBYTES_20 60c5ff20d9b2609aa2feb39237125b26e125150b OP_EQUAL
address
MGirHtbvBCcTkA3VwpaxEPQDDvL5R6ncJr
transaction
63d683675620c0d8f8bf813d2261273d3da22bc452bd1d3925542c20dcb703d5
spent
true